  • Patent number: 8087549
    Abstract: In a liquid supply apparatus, a liquid held in a liquid holding portion is pushed out to the exterior by pressurized gas. The apparatus includes a liquid pouring section for pouring a predetermined amount of liquid into an intermediate portion of the liquid holding portion, a liquid discharge portion which comprises a thin pipe smaller in flow passage cross-sectional area than the liquid holing portion, and is connected to one end of the liquid holding portion, a liquid storing portion which is larger in flow passage cross-sectional area than the liquid holding portion, and is connected to the other end of the liquid holding portion, and a gas feed section for feeding the pressurized gas into the liquid storing portion. The apparatus further includes at least one of first fault detection section for detecting a fault of the liquid pouring section and second fault detection section for detecting a fault of the gas feed section.
